Jack H. Kellen, 87, of
Mendota died Dec. 17,
2012, in his residence.
Services will be at 11 a.m.
Thursday in St. John's Lutheran
Church, Mendota with the Rev. Dale
Peterson officiating. Burial will be
at Restland Cemetery, Mendota with
military rites by VFW Post 4079.
Visitation is 4-7 p.m. Wednesday
at Merritt Funeral Home, Mendota.
Mr. Kellen was born Feb. 11, 1925,
in Amboy to Nicholas and Catherine
(Faivre) Kellen. He married Carol
Johnson on Oct. 29, 1975, in Ottawa.
He was a member
of St. John's
Lutheran Church
in Mendota where
he served as an
usher and greeter.
A graduate
of Amboy
High School, he
served with the
U.S. Army in the
European Theater
of Operations during
World War II. He was a member
and past commander of VFW Post
4079, member of Elks Lodge 1212,
American Legion and Mendota Golf
Club.
He served as an alderman on
Mendota City Council for eight years,
coached Little League Baseball for 10
years and was a volunteer at Mendota
Community Hospital. He also served
seven years in Environmental Standards
And Controls for Woodhaven Lakes
Association.
He owned and operated Chalet
Restaurant in Mendota and was a
supervisor with Commonwealth
Edison for 38 years before retirement.
